Students Ceyda Demirkoparan and Ali Enes Akdemir from the Land Registry and Cadastre Program of the Department of Architecture and Urban Planning at Bartın University (BARÜ) Ulus Vocational School have been selected to participate in the Erasmus+ Study Mobility Programme in Poland.

Having successfully completed the Erasmus+ student selection process, the students will study at the Radom Academy of Economics in Radom, Poland, during the Fall Semester of the 2026–2027 Academic Year. Following the successful completion of the application, admission, and inter-institutional communication processes coordinated by Lect. Dr. Hatice Ay, Erasmus Unit Coordinator of Ulus Vocational School, the students were officially presented with their letters of acceptance.

Commenting on the achievement, Assoc. Prof. Dr. Şükrü Teoman Güner, Director of Ulus Vocational School, expressed his satisfaction with the students' success and stated: "The international academic experience our students will gain will make a significant contribution both to their professional careers and to the vision of our vocational school. I congratulate Ceyda Demirkoparan and Ali Enes Akdemir and wish them every success in their studies in Poland. I would also like to express my sincere appreciation to our Erasmus Unit Coordinator, Lect. Dr. Hatice Ay, and to Bartłomiej Świostek, Erasmus+ Coordinator at the Radom Academy of Economics, for their valuable support and contributions in successfully managing the mobility process and completing our students' admission procedures."

The Erasmus+ mobility programme aims to enhance the students' academic and professional competencies in an international environment, improve their foreign language proficiency, and strengthen their ability to adapt to a global academic community. In addition to supporting the students' personal and professional development, this mobility is expected to contribute to Bartın University's internationalisation strategy and further strengthen the global academic collaborations of Ulus Vocational School.
